Output ce2a040fa196b063fd04e4913181b1a2455a557fee23df24e48440c60124e5c4:14

value
8216621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e548f02a87c99c13352c0a11126ecbfd9ed3e25b OP_EQUAL
address
3NbN3Jc6wy4hzBLVxNaUCvYozRBg8Jdk1r
transaction
ce2a040fa196b063fd04e4913181b1a2455a557fee23df24e48440c60124e5c4
confirmations
255726
spent
true